Common Causes of Broken Conservatory Glass
Several elements can cause broken conservatory glass, which can vary from ecological components to wear and tear in time. Here are some of the more prevalent causes:
1. Climate condition
Extreme climate condition can take a toll on conservatory glass.
Hailstorms: Hail can produce cracks or shatter glass panels.High Winds: Wind can trigger challenge hit the glass, causing damage.Temperature level Fluctuations: Rapid changes in temperature level can create thermal stress in the glass, possibly causing it to break.2. Accidental Damage
Accidental impacts are among the most common causes of broken conservatory glass.
Football and Other Sports: Balls kicked or thrown during outside video games can damage the glass.Falling Branches: Trees near the conservatory can lose branches throughout storms or high winds.3. Poor Installation
Improper setup can result in tension on the glass, leading to damage in time.
Insufficient Support: Glass panels need proper framing and assistance to endure external forces.Poor Quality Glass: Using low-quality materials can result in fragility.4. Aging and Wear
As the conservatory ages, so does its glass.
Weakening Seals: Weather seals can deteriorate, triggering water to seep in and eventually lead to glass damage.Structural Weakness: Over time, the wear on the structure may cause issues with glass integrity.Solutions for Broken Conservatory Glass
When conservatory glass is broken, it's vital to attend to the problem promptly to avoid additional damage and maintain the structure's stability. Here are some immediate services:
1. Safety Measures
Before taking any action, security needs to be the top priority.
Use Protective Gear: Ensure to use gloves and safety goggles to secure versus sharp edges.Clear the Area: Keep family pets and kids away up until the area is secured.2. Short-term Fixes
While you organize for professional aid, think about temporary options.
Usage Clear Plastic Sheeting: This can temporarily protect the opening from the elements.Duct Tape: If the glass is split however not totally shattered, duct tape may hold it momentarily.3. Professional Repair Options
Contacting the experts is frequently the very best course of action.
Glass Replacement: Professionals can replace the broken glass panel, guaranteeing that quality products are used.Structural Assessment: It's important to have a professional evaluate any possible underlying structural issues that might have contributed to the damage.4. Do it yourself Repairs
For those comfy with DIY tasks, small repairs can be made.
Glass Repair Kits: There are numerous sets available for fixing minor fractures. However, be cautious as this may not be a long-lasting solution.Replacement Panels: If the damage is small and restricted to a single panel, DIY replacement may be feasible with the right tools and products.Maintenance Tips to Prevent Future Breakage
To prevent instances of broken conservatory glass in the future, consider these maintenance tips:
1. Regular Inspections
Performing regular inspections can help capture prospective problems early.
Check for Cracks: Regularly inspect glass panels for initial indications of stress or fractures.Examine Seals and Frames: Ensure that seals and frames remain in great condition to prevent leaks and pressure points.2. Appropriate Landscaping
The location surrounding the conservatory plays a vital role in maintaining glass stability.
Trim Overhanging Branches: This decreases the risk of falling debris during storms or high winds.Protect Outdoor Furniture: Keep light-weight furnishings secured to prevent it from becoming a projectile during bad weather.3. Seasonal Preparations
Preparing the conservatory for seasonal modifications can mitigate damage from the aspects.
Storm Windows: Installing storm windows can provide additional protection throughout extreme weather condition.Winter Maintenance: Ensure that snow and ice are routinely cleared from the roof to prevent extreme weight.FAQs About Broken Conservatory GlassQ1: What should I do immediately after the glass breaks?
A1: Ensure your safety initially. Use protective equipment and remove any neighboring dangers. Then, either cover the area momentarily or contact a professional for repairs.
Q2: Can I replace the glass myself?
A2: While small damages can often be repaired with DIY methods, it's usually best to work with a professional, particularly for big or structural panels.
Q3: How can I avoid my conservatory glass from breaking?
A3: Regular examinations, appropriate landscaping, and preparing for seasonal weather changes can assist prevent glass breakage.
Q4: Is there a way to repair a crack in the glass?
A4: Small cracks can sometimes be repaired with a glass repair package offered in stores. Nevertheless, this is typically not a long-term solution, and replacement is generally advised.
Q5: What kind of glass is perfect for conservatories?
A5: Double-glazed or toughened glass is recommended for conservatories as it offers better insulation and is more resistant to breakage.
